Default Reverie HT (Tour) - Full Screen Theme - Free

Reverie HT is a follow up to the original Reverie, and like it's predecessor, is intended to show off your wallpaper.

Enjoy!


(Bold 9000 version shown w/ custom wallpaper, available below)

Theme by Marc J.S. (AKA dagobah30)





Installation:

To install this theme, open the OTA link that pertains to the version you want from within your BlackBerry browser. Desktop installation is not available.

The dates are in MM/DD/YY format.

*NOTE* In order for the shortcuts and hidden today feature of the theme to work properly, your SMS and Email Inboxes must be manually set in accordance with the version you're using.

*NOTE* If you are installing an "OS 5.0" specific version of the theme over an "OS 4.X-5.0" version, you may need to reset the home screen layout to its default. To do this, go to Options > Themes > (the Reverie theme you are using) > Theme Defaults. Then, select only Layout and hit Apply. A device restart / battery pull may then also be required.

*NOTE* The home screen's wallpaper will show through on the app screen only on the "OS 4.X-5.0" versions of the theme. The "OS 5.0" specific versions of the theme do not have this feature.

*NOTE* You may encounter a white background on the app screen when using the "OS 4.X-5.0" versions of the theme on OS 5.0. (The "OS 5.0" specific versions of the theme do not have this problem.) A fix for this can be found here.

Features:

Weather Slot
The theme is available both with and without a slot for your weather app. To use the weather slot version, simply place your weather app in the first spot on your application screen and it will show up on your home and lock screens. Scrolling to the weather slot on the home screen will show its status text.

Clickable Bottom Bar
Every part of the home screen's bar is clickable, providing easy access to your calender, messages, options, clock, connection manager, profiles, and one app of your choice... Place an app in the first spot on your application screen in the versions without a weather slot, or in the second spot in the versions with a weather slot, and you'll be able to access that app via the "square" button.

Hidden Today
Scroll to either the calender or messages icon on the home screen's bar for a preview of corresponding entries.

QuickLaunch/ShortcutMe Hotkey
The spacebar on your device's keyboard functions as a hotkey for both QuickLaunch and ShortcutMe. (You need to have either QuickLaunch or ShortcutMe installed in order for this feature to work.)

Transitions
This theme is available both with and without transitions. In the transitions versions, a fade effect will occur whenever the screen changes. (You need to be running OS 5.0 in order to install the transitions versions.)
